Medical negligence is defined by an infringement of a health care provider’s legal obligation to the patient that results in death or injury. Your attorney will have to establish that the birth injury to your child was the result of medical malpractice. This means that the health care provider in question didn't meet accepted standards of treatment for professionals and that this failure led to the injuries. This means reviewing medical records, obtaining expert opinions and identifying any policies or procedures that have been breached.

Fortunately, New York does not have a limit on damages for medical malpractice, including birth injury claims. As a result, you could be able to recover compensation for the extent of your child's injury and their long-term needs. This can include medical expenses, lost wages from missing work, home care costs therapy equipment, and discomfort and pain.

If a doctor or other medical professional fails to take appropriate actions during the labor and delivery process, it is considered to be a case of malpractice. This can be based on a range of issues, like the misinterpretation of fetal heart rates and the use of medications during delivery, or inability of the doctor to react to symptoms of distress in the fetus. These types of errors may cause oxygen deprivation. This is referred to as hypoxic ischemic brain damage, or ischemia. This condition can cause serious brain damage by cutting off oxygen and nutrients.

Other examples of medical mistakes that can lead to birth injuries include the improper use of tools for delivery and equipment, handling a baby's abnormal posture or administering the incorrect medication. These types of cases are usually called birth trauma or medically-induced trauma, and they can occur during vaginal and cesarean delivery.
